What shuck means
To remove the outer shell, husk, or covering from something, especially oysters, clams, corn, or other food items.
Where the word comes from
From Middle English *schucken*, likely of uncertain origin but possibly related to Old English *scucca* (demon, evil spirit) or influenced by Low German *schucken* (to shake, shrug). The sense shifted from a physical jerking motion to removing an outer covering, as when shucking oysters or corn husks. The exact path remains unclear, but the word has been used since at least the 1600s.
